    A box has 210 coins of denominations one rupee and fifty paise only. The ratio of their respective values is 13 : 11. The number of one rupee coins is

    A)  65       

    B)                     66

    C)  77                               

    D)  78

    Correct Answer: D

    Solution :

    Respective ratio of the number of coins \[=13:11\times 2=13:22\] \[\therefore \] Number of Rs.1 coins \[=\frac{13}{13+22}\times 210\] \[=\frac{13}{35}\times 210=78\]
